No person shall deface, destroy, vandalize or
otherwise damage public or private property by painting, writing,
drawing, inscribing or otherwise applying in any fashion what is defined
herein as graffiti.
No person shall write or cause to be written
any lewd, indecent or obscene word or words, marks or mark whatsoever,
or draw or cause to be drawn any lewd, indecent or obscene figure,
upon any house, building, wall, fence or other place in the Township.
A.
Sale to minors. No business or person shall sell or
otherwise transfer any spray paint container or indelible marker to
a minor unless said minor is accompanied by a parent or legal guardian
at the time of purchase or transfer.
B.
False identification. No minor shall, at the time
of purchase of any spray paint container or indelible marker, knowingly
furnish fraudulent evidence of majority, including, but not limited
to, a motor vehicle operator's license, a registration certificate
issued under the Federal Selective Service Act, an identification
card issued to a member of the armed forces or any document issued
by a federal, state, county or municipal government.
C.
Notice. Every business or person selling spray paint
containers or indelible markers shall place a sign in clear public
view near the display of such products stating:[1]
THE SALE OR TRANSFER OF SPRAY PAINT CONTAINERS
OR WIDE-TIPPED INDELIBLE MARKERS TO PERSONS UNDER 18 YEARS OF AGE
NOT ACCOMPANIED BY A PARENT OR LEGAL GUARDIAN IS PROHIBITED IN THE
TOWNSHIP OF MONTVILLE. VIOLATORS MAY BE PUNISHED BY A FINE OF UP TO
$2,000 OR IMPRISONED FOR A PERIOD NOT TO EXCEED 90 DAYS INCLUDING
A SENTENCE OF COMMUNITY SERVICE.

A.
Any owner or agent thereof shall procure the removal
of any graffiti from his property immediately or within 30 days of
receipt of notice from the Township to remove such graffiti. If the
owner or agent of such property fails to remove the graffiti in a
timely manner, the Township shall cause the graffiti to be removed
and charge the property owner for the expenses incurred. Failure of
the property owner to pay the Township shall result in the expenses
being placed as a municipal lien upon the property as permitted by
law.
B.
The Township police officers and code enforcement officers are hereby authorized to enforce the provisions of this chapter, including the issuance of summonses and notices required under Subsection C of this section.
C.
Whenever the Township becomes aware of the existence
of graffiti on any property, including structures or improvements
within the Township, a Zoning Enforcement Officer or a police officer
shall give or cause to be given notice to the property owner and/or
owner's agent or manager to remove such graffiti therefrom. Such notice
shall be in writing and have substantially the following form:

No person shall bring into or have in any park
within the Township any destructive device or can, aerosol can, tube
or other object containing paint or similar substance. The term "destructive
device" means anything readily capable of damaging or defacing any
building, facility, structure, improvement or natural feature within
the parks. Nothing in this section shall prohibit any person from
bringing or having such items in said parks for lawful recreational
or business purposes.
B.
Pursuant to N.J.S.A. 2A:53A-15, any parent, guardian
or other person having legal custody of a minor who fails or neglects
to exercise reasonable supervision and control of such minor shall
be liable in a civil action for any destruction or damage caused by
such minor offender pursuant to this chapter.
